SPX Technologies Announces Planned Leadership Transition in Detection & Measurement Segment

https://www.quiverquant.com/news/SPX+Technologies+Announces+Planned+Leadership+Transition+in+Detection+%26+Measurement+Segment
SPX Technologies announced a leadership transition in its Detection & Measurement segment, with John Swann set to retire in January 2027 and Eric Kaled taking over as segment leader on August 31, 2026. Gene Lowe, CEO, praised Swann's significant contributions since 2004, while Kaled, who joined in 2019, is recognized for his strong performance and strategic leadership. Swann will assist with strategic initiatives until the end of the year to ensure a seamless leadership handoff.

Why SPX Technologies (SPXC) Is Becoming a Clearer Data Center Cooling Play as HVAC Backlog Builds

https://www.insidermonkey.com/blog/why-spx-technologies-spxc-is-becoming-a-clearer-data-center-cooling-play-as-hvac-backlog-builds-1783749/
SPX Technologies (SPXC) is emerging as a significant player in data center cooling, driven by growing demand and a robust HVAC backlog. The company is investing over $100 million to expand its HVAC manufacturing capacity, with its HVAC segment revenue increasing 22% year-over-year and backlog reaching $755 million. SPX also recently launched the Marley OlympusMAX Fluid Cooler, a modular cooling platform designed for high-density cooling applications and hyperscale data centers.

Why SPX Technologies Stock’s Income Statement Tells a Different Story Than the Start-Up Cost Headlines in 2026

https://www.tikr.com/blog/why-spx-technologies-stocks-income-statement-tells-a-different-story-than-the-start-up-cost-headlines-in-2026
SPX Technologies (SPXC) exceeded Q1 2026 estimates, driven by a 17% year-over-year revenue increase and a significant acceleration in data center cooling demand, leading to raised full-year guidance. Despite temporary start-up costs impacting HVAC segment margins, the company demonstrates strong operating leverage and maintains a substantial operating margin advantage over competitors like Rexnord and Watts Water. TIKR's mid-case valuation suggests a 47% total return by December 2034, indicating the market may not yet fully price in the benefits of SPXC's capacity expansion and data center revenue ramp.
